TutorRight, let us look at the two interview case studies you prepared. Ryan, what happened with the first candidate, Anna?
RyanShe had excellent qualifications but froze when asked about a time she had failed. She had not prepared for negative questions at all.
PriyaI noticed the same. She also sat with crossed arms and avoided eye contact, which the interviewers found off-putting.
TutorGood. And what did the second candidate, Ben, do differently?
RyanBen used the STAR method every time — Situation, Task, Action, Result. His answers were clear and had a logical structure.
PriyaHe also asked really good questions at the end — things about the team culture and development opportunities. That made a strong impression.
